How Our Team Handles Black Water Extraction (Category 3)
With black water extraction, every minute counts. That’s why our team is available 24/7 to respond to emergency calls. We’ll arrive on the scene quickly, assess the damage, and start the extraction process. We’ll use our truck-mounted pumps to extract the contaminated water and then we’ll use our professional-grade drying equipment to dry out your property. This process can take anywhere from 3-5 days depending on the severity of the damage and the size of the affected area.
Step 1: Assessment and Containment
Our team will arrive on the scene and assess the damage to find out the extent of the contamination. We’ll then contain the affected area to prevent further damage and ensure the safety of everyone involved. We’ll use our containment equipment to prevent the spread of contaminants and then we’ll start the extraction process. This step is crucial in preventing further damage and ensuring the safety of your property and occupants.
Step 2: Extraction
Our team will use our truck-mounted pumps to extract the contaminated water from your property. We’ll remove up to 2 inches of standing water in a single pass, and then we’ll use our professional-grade drying equipment to dry out the affected area. This process can take several hours depending on the severity of the damage and the size of the affected area.
Step 3: Drying
Once the extraction process is complete, our team will use our professional-grade drying equipment to dry out the affected area. We’ll use our desiccant dehumidifiers to remove excess moisture and then we’ll use our air movers to speed up the drying process. This step is crucial in preventing further damage and ensuring the safety of your property and occupants.
Step 4: Sanitizing and Disinfecting
Once the drying process is complete, our team will sanitize and disinfect the affected area to prevent the growth of mold and bacteria. We’ll use our professional-grade sanitizing equipment to kill any remaining contaminants, and then we’ll use our disinfecting agents to prevent future growth. This step is crucial in ensuring the safety of your property and occupants.

Black Water Extraction (Category 3) Cost in Salem, MA
The cost of black water extraction can vary depending on the severity of the damage, the size of the affected area, and local conditions in Salem, MA. Here are some estimated costs for different services involved in black water extraction:
| Service | Typical Price Range | What Affects Cost |
|---|---|---|
| Extraction | $500 – $2,500 | Size of affected area, severity of damage, and local conditions. |
| Drying | $1,000 – $5,000 | Size of affected area, severity of damage, and local conditions. |
| Sanitizing and Disinfecting | $500 – $2,000 | Size of affected area, severity of damage, and local conditions. |
| Removal of Contaminated Materials | $1,000 – $5,000 | Size of affected area, severity of damage, and local conditions. |
